推荐使用:generator-polymer —— 轻松构建Web组件的利器!

推荐使用:generator-polymer —— 轻松构建Web组件的利器!

项目简介

在Web开发领域,generator-polymer 是一个强大的 Yeoman 生成器,它专门用于构建基于 Polymer 的项目。Polymer 是一个领先的Web组件库,能让你在现代浏览器中充分利用Web组件技术。通过generator-polymer,你可以快速搭建项目框架,并自定义创建Polymer元素,大幅提高开发效率。

项目技术分析

generator-polymer 深度整合了 Polymer Starter Kitseed-element,具备以下核心特性:

  1. 使用流行的 Yeoman 工具进行命令行操作,实现自动化项目结构生成。
  2. 提供子生成器用于创建可定制的Polymer元素,并自动将其引入到项目中。
  3. 支持一键部署到GitHub Pages,方便代码分享和预览。
  4. 集成了 web-component-tester,确保组件的高质量测试。

此外,项目还支持 Polymer CLI,提供更加丰富的功能和更广泛的社区支持。

应用场景

generator-polymer 广泛适用于各种Web应用程序的开发,特别是在以下几个方面表现出卓越的优势:

  • 快速启动新项目:只需几条命令,即可构建出完整的Polymer应用框架。
  • 动态构建Web组件:轻松创建和管理自定义的Polymer元素,便于复用和扩展。
  • 简化文档与测试:内建的文档生成和测试工具使维护工作变得更加简单。
  • 跨平台兼容:利用Web组件技术,实现跨浏览器的应用开发。

项目特点

  1. 易用性:通过命令行简单操作,即可完成复杂的项目构建任务。
  2. 高效性:避免手动编写重复的模板代码,提高开发速度。
  3. 灵活性:允许自定义元素路径,满足复杂项目结构需求。
  4. 可靠性:集成种子项目最佳实践,保证项目质量。
  5. 社区支持:背靠Polymer和Yeoman两大社区,问题解决及时,更新迭代迅速。

总结起来,generator-polymer 不仅是一个工具,更是Web开发者手中的瑞士军刀,帮助你在Web组件的世界里游刃有余。无论你是初涉Web组件的新手还是经验丰富的老手,都能从中受益匪浅。现在就加入我们,一起体验generator-polymer带来的开发乐趣吧!

  • 4
    点赞
  • 9
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
在您提供的引用中,出现了一个错误信息"Cannot resolve plugin org.mybatis.generator:mybatis-generator-maven-plugin:1.3.0"。这个错误通常表示Maven无法解析或找到所需的插件。根据您的引用内容,我可以提供以下解决方法: 1. 确保您的Maven配置文件中的依赖项正确配置。检查您的pom.xml文件中是否添加了正确的插件依赖以及其版本号。 2. 检查您的Maven仓库中是否存在所需的插件。您可以尝试删除Maven本地仓库中与该插件相关的文件,然后重新运行Maven命令,以便重新下载并安装插件。 3. 检查您的网络连接是否正常。有时候插件无法下载是由于网络问题导致的。您可以尝试使用其他网络或者使用代理进行连接。 4. 尝试使用更新的插件版本。您提供的引用中使用的是1.3.0版本的插件,尝试使用更高版本的插件,可能会解决该问题。 总结起来,要解决"Cannot resolve plugin org.mybatis.generator:mybatis-generator-maven-plugin:1.3.0"的问题,您可以检查Maven配置文件、Maven仓库、网络连接并尝试更新插件版本。<span class="em">1</span><span class="em">2</span><span class="em">3</span> #### 引用[.reference_title] - *1* *3* [Failed to execute goal org.mybatis.generator:mybatis-generator-maven-plugin:1.3.6:generate (default-](https://blog.csdn.net/qq_52291182/article/details/121033304)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"] - *2* [Maven更新失败,Cannot resolve plugin org.apache.maven.plugins:maven-compiler-plugin:3.1](https://download.csdn.net/download/weixin_38687277/14888111)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"] [ .reference_list ]
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

尤琦珺Bess

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值